Subject: Quotaforge cut-over complete — please review

Welcome aboard! Last night we finished migrating tenant rate limiting from the legacy Gatewarden proxy to Quotaforge. Each tenant now gets an isolated token bucket, refilled per minute, with burst headroom negotiated at onboarding. Overrides for the three largest tenants were carried across manually by Priya. The new per-tenant quota settings are as follows.

settings of tagef-bawif:
DRUIX_HOST=druix.zemvarlabs.internal
DRUIX_PORT=8000

Runbook fragment — Canary gating for the Ostenfeld checkout service. Promotions from canary to full rollout are blocked unless error rate stays under the threshold for two consecutive evaluation windows and latency p99 remains within budget. Reviewers should verify that any change to these gates is reflected in both the pipeline definition and the service manifest. The gating parameters currently in effect are listed below.

deployment values, fafog-yahag:
[druath]
port = 3000
region = west-3
host = druath.norvatech.test
team = novvan
timeout_ms = 2000
retries = 2

Leadership review briefing — Logistics transition

For the heads of department: after a structured evaluation, we recommend replacing Corvale Shipping with Lantenbury Freight across all regions. Lantenbury offers stronger on-time performance, consolidated invoicing, and capacity on the Westfell routes. Transition costs are modest and recoverable within two quarters. The confidential note on associated business plans follows directly below.

board note of badup-yagug: Project Kelmir slips by six weeks because of the staffing delay.

## Build Provenance: Currency Rounding Fix

The Tollgate conversion service in Finwick's Penchant platform accumulated sub-cent drift because intermediate rates were stored as binary floats before the 3.9 release. All conversions now use fixed-point arithmetic with banker's rounding applied only at the final step. Future maintainers should verify that any backported patch preserves this ordering, since reintroducing early rounding silently corrupts reconciliation totals. The provenance token for the corrected artifact appears directly below.

session token of bawep-yadup = htk21_528abd376e3c5a4ec24a1